Residential Hardscaping in Boston, MA
Residential hardscaping services encompass a variety of exterior improvements that en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of a property’s outdoor space. Common projects include installing pat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or living areas such as fire pits or seating areas. These features are designed to provide durable, low-maintenance surfaces and structures that complement the landscape while increasing usable space for leisure, entertainment, or everyday activities.
Homeowners interested in residential hardscaping should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, preferred materials, and the overall style of the property. It’s important to understand the scope of the project, including site preparation, material selection, and any necessary permits or regulations in the area. Gathering information about design preferences and budget expectations can help ensure the hardscaping work a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ic goals.

Residential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are included in residential hardscaping services? Residential hardscaping typically involves pat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or living spaces designed to enhance property functionality and appearance.
How does hardscaping improve property value? Hardscaping adds aesthetic appeal and functional outdoor areas, which can increase curb appeal and overall property value for homeowners.
What materials are commonly used in residential hardscaping? Common materials include concrete, pavers, brick, natural stone, and gravel, chosen for durability and visual appeal.
Are hardscaping features suitable for small yards? Yes, hardscaping can be customized to fit smaller spaces, creating practical and attractive outdoor areas without overwhelming the property.
